$2.50 bottle from Parkhurst Wine Shop at Rainbow Hill. No date on this one, but some other bottles from this place have been past best by date. Pours clear orange with a small head. Aroma is very much pumpkin pine: pumpkin spice, whipped cream, crust. Flavor is very similar, and pumpkin pie is one of the few sweets I like. This is pumpkin, cinnamon, nutmeg, ginger, crust, whipped cream. Finishes with a lingering bittering nutmeg/clove flavor. I like this a lot. No issues with freshness here, or if there was it's still good.

12 ounce bottle from Beer Run. Clear copper, thin foamy tan head, fair retention. Aroma of pumpkin spice, pumpkin, a charred note, mild caramel and vanilla. The taste is pumpkin, vanilla, spice, caramel. Thin bodied.
